Output 76c356f73ea86b29ffd8f9a00531d2fb3906fd96c50dbef53b267f06ffec0bb9:0

value
51145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c8b67b28cb4da61daf728c1027e081418cc65c8 OP_EQUAL
address
35kYf21cCj4cRr2nxUnXizXrGfcMCzGA68
transaction
76c356f73ea86b29ffd8f9a00531d2fb3906fd96c50dbef53b267f06ffec0bb9
confirmations
94111
spent
true